IBA Karachi Solar Installation
Solar Citizen designed and installed a 65kW solar power system at the Institute of Business Administration (IBA) in Karachi. IBA is one of Pakistan’s most prestigious educational institutions, and this project reflects our capability in delivering solar solutions for campus environments.
Project Overview
| Detail | Specification |
|---|---|
| Client | Institute of Business Administration (IBA) |
| Location | Karachi |
| System Size | 65 kW |
| System Type | Grid-tied rooftop |
| Panels | Tier-1 N-type TOPCon |
| Monitoring | Sol AI real-time platform |
Campus Energy Context
Educational institutions face a specific energy profile. Classrooms, computer labs, server rooms, and administrative offices create variable demand patterns across the day. Campus buildings often have large, flat rooftops well-suited for solar, but electrical infrastructure varies between older and newer blocks. IBA’s campus in Karachi presented exactly this mix of opportunity and complexity.
The Challenge
The project required careful coordination with campus operations. Installation work needed to avoid disrupting academic schedules. Electrical integration had to interface with existing campus power infrastructure, including backup generators and UPS systems. Roof space was shared across multiple potential uses, requiring optimized panel placement within designated areas.
Karachi’s coastal climate added environmental considerations. Salt air, high humidity, and extreme summer temperatures demand equipment and mounting solutions rated for harsh conditions.
The Solution
• Engineered system design. Full structural and electrical survey conducted before design. Panel layout optimized for the specific roof sections allocated by IBA administration.
• Climate-appropriate equipment. All components selected for Karachi’s coastal conditions. Corrosion-resistant mounting hardware. Panels with strong temperature coefficients for high-heat performance.
• Scheduled installation. Work phased to align with campus calendar, minimizing disruption to academic activities.
• Sol AI monitoring. Every string monitored individually with automated performance tracking and fault detection. The university administration has dashboard access to real-time and historical generation data.

Solar for Educational Institutions
Universities, colleges, and schools across Pakistan are adopting solar to manage rising energy costs. Large rooftop areas, daytime peak demand that aligns with solar generation, and institutional commitment to sustainability make educational campuses ideal for solar.
